As for which packs I wanted to see added to/improved upon, I voted for Island Living (I would like to see water skiing, surfing and underwater lots to explore and live in if your sim is a mermaid.), Get To Work (I'd like to see more active careers and for aliens to be expanded on...more powers, ufos and being able to live in the alien world.), and Seasons (I think Seasons is great but I would like to see more seasonal activities like sledding, seasonal festivals, and rainy day activities like coloring books, board games and puzzles.) As for the CAS options like to see, I suggested more fantasy elements for our sims like wings, horns, capes, crowns and the ability to have two different colored eyes. I voted for Island Living and Cats & Dogs to get some extra polish. For island living I hope there was more to do, hoping for an underwater lot? Cats and dogs I think need re-evaluation of how long the walks take and also how the pets getting sick all the time affects rotational play. I do consider these as bugs to be fixed but hey I've been waiting this long and it hasn't happened, so please pay some attention to the pack. Sure it would be fun if something else got added too.
